Arrive at Guwahati Airport, where you will be warmly welcomed and taken to your comfortable hotel. After you have settled in, explore the famous Kamakhya Temple, a holy place dedicated to the mother goddess Kamakhya and one of the oldest Shakti Pithas, richin stories and spiritual power.
In the afternoon, take a relaxing cruise along the beautiful Brahmaputra River, enjoying the lively riverside scenes. In the evening, stroll through busy local markets like Pan Bazaar, Paltan Bazaar, Fancy Bazaar, and Uzan Bazaar, where you can find fragrant tea leaves, beautiful handmade crafts, shining Assam Silk, soothing Singing Bowls, and special Assamese jewellery. Then return to your hotel for a peaceful night’s rest.
After breakfast, check out of the hotel and head to Shillong. On the way, stop at Umiam Lake to enjoy tasty momos while admiring the beautiful lake views. When you arrive, check into the hotel. Once you’ve freshened up, go on a local sightseeing tour of Shillong, visiting Don Bosco Museum, Lady Hydari Park, and Ward’s Lake. In the evening, visit the popular Police Bazar market in Shillong, known for its unique traditional crafts, beautiful Meghalaya products, local clothing, costume jewellery, and more. Stay overnight at the hotel.
After breakfast, start your journey to Cherrapunji, the place with the most rainfall in the world. On the way, stop at Elephant Falls and Shillong Peak. When you reach Cherrapunji, visit Noh-ka-Likai Falls, Mawsmai Cave, Don Bosco Shrine, Wah Kaba Falls, Kynrem Falls, Arwah Cave, and other nearby caves.
Stay overnight at a hotel in Cherrapunji.
After breakfast, go on a day trip to Mawlynnong, the cleanest village in Asia. Visit the Jingmaham Living Root Bridge there. Then, travel to Dawki, a small border town in the Jaintia Hills, known for the beautiful Umngot River. Enjoy a peaceful boat ride.After that, leave for Shillong. On arrival, check in to the hotel for an overnight stay
After breakfast, check out from the hotel and go sightseeing in Shillong to see the city’s popular spots. Then, head to Kaziranga. Kaziranga National Park is one of the most popular places in Assam, known for the one-horned rhinoceros. It is also home to many wild animals like tigers, wild buffalo, gaur, leopards, stags, deer, hogs, and wild boars, as well as many beautiful migratory birds.
On arrival, check in at the hotel. The rest of the day is free for leisure. Overnight stay at the hotel.
Early in the morning, go on an elephant safari (5:30 AM to 6:30 AM) in the western part of the park. Enjoy the birdsong and the fresh scent of wildflowers, making the experience even more magical. The main animals you can see here include the one-horned rhinoceros, tiger, wild buffalo, elephant, various deer, python, and many migratory birds. Return for some refreshments.
After breakfast, visit a nearby local village to see how people live and work, then explore the Tea Garden and the Orchid Sanctuary. Some well-known Tea Gardens are Methoni, Hathkhuli, Difalu, Borchapori, and Behora.
After lunch, head back to the park for another wildlife safari by jeep. The evening is free to relax. Overnight stay at the hotel.
After breakfast, check out from the hotel and head to Nimati Ghat to catch a ferry to Majuli, the world’s largest river island and home to Vaishnavite monasteries. You will cross the Brahmaputra River by ferry to get there. Once on the island, enjoy the natural surroundings and take a relaxing walk. Stay overnight at the hotel.
After breakfast, visit Kamalabari Satra and Auniati Satra, major centres of Vaishnavite culture. Visits to these places would be conducted in the morning.
Here you can enjoy the natural beauty and explore the area. Discover the secrets of Majuli and learn about the old art of mask-making used in the “Bhaona” play, which tells stories from Hindu mythology. Spend the rest of the day with local people, learning about their traditional arts and crafts.
In the afternoon, leave Majuli for Jorhat, and stay overnight at a pre-booked hotel.
After breakfast, check out of the hotel and travel to Kohima. When you arrive, check into the hotel. The rest of the day is free to relax. Stay overnight at the hotel.
After breakfast, drive to Khonoma, known for its history of warfare. Surrounded by green hills, the village is famous for its community efforts and was named the country’s first green village.
After breakfast, go on a local sightseeing tour of Kohima, visiting popular places like Kohima Museum, the Cathedral Church, and Kohima War Cemetery. The cemetery was made to remember soldiers who died during the Second World War. It was built by the Japanese forces who had invaded the area.
The evening is free for shopping in the local market. The main things to look for are woven bamboo, tribal shawls, jewellery, beadwork, and trendy clothes. Handwoven items are also popular in the marketsof Kohima.
